Comprised of chapters carefully selected from CRC's best-selling engineering handbooks, volumes in the Principles and Applications in Engineering series provide convenient, economical references sharply focused on particular engineering topics and subspecialties. Culled from the Biomedical Engineering Handbook, Biomedical Imaging provides an overview of the main medical imaging devices and highlights emerging systems.
